Transaction 73752948f06a5266941a511db72ff623d68757b95be650968ea3a680dd6212c3

1 Input
2 Outputs
  • 73752948f06a5266941a511db72ff623d68757b95be650968ea3a680dd6212c3:0
  • value  12613
    address  1N7iyUN54Ha2C1YRYyYqEZM6gqKgRt7Qba
  • 73752948f06a5266941a511db72ff623d68757b95be650968ea3a680dd6212c3:1
  • value  1900000
    address  1HHHSoURmKmERoxBPSnHTtHWhWpkLX23LF